Searched refs:NewDeduced (Results 1 – 2 of 2) sorted by relevance
/freebsd/contrib/llvm-project/clang/lib/Sema/ |
H A D | SemaTemplateDeduction.cpp | 401 const DeducedTemplateArgument &NewDeduced, QualType ValueType, in DeduceNonTypeTemplateArgument() argument 408 S.Context, Deduced[NTTP->getIndex()], NewDeduced); in DeduceNonTypeTemplateArgument() 412 Info.SecondArg = NewDeduced; in DeduceNonTypeTemplateArgument() 447 /*ArrayBound=*/NewDeduced.wasDeducedFromArrayBound()); in DeduceNonTypeTemplateArgument() 585 auto NewDeduced = DeducedTemplateArgument(Arg); in DeduceTemplateArguments() local 609 NewDeduced = DeducedTemplateArgument( in DeduceTemplateArguments() 620 NewDeduced); in DeduceTemplateArguments() 624 Info.SecondArg = NewDeduced; in DeduceTemplateArguments() 1699 DeducedTemplateArgument NewDeduced(DeducedType, DeducedFromArrayBound); in DeduceTemplateArgumentsByTypeMatch() local 1701 checkDeducedTemplateArguments(S.Context, Deduced[Index], NewDeduced); in DeduceTemplateArgumentsByTypeMatch() [all …]
|
H A D | TreeTransform.h | 6773 QualType NewDeduced; in TransformDeducedTemplateSpecializationType() local 6775 NewDeduced = getDerived().TransformType(OldDeduced); in TransformDeducedTemplateSpecializationType() 6776 if (NewDeduced.isNull()) in TransformDeducedTemplateSpecializationType() 6781 TemplateName, NewDeduced); in TransformDeducedTemplateSpecializationType() 7093 QualType NewDeduced; in TransformAutoType() local 7095 NewDeduced = getDerived().TransformType(OldDeduced); in TransformAutoType() 7096 if (NewDeduced.isNull()) in TransformAutoType() 7126 if (getDerived().AlwaysRebuild() || NewDeduced != OldDeduced || in TransformAutoType() 7133 Result = getDerived().RebuildAutoType(NewDeduced, T->getKeyword(), NewCD, in TransformAutoType()
|